[QUOTE="Anonymous, post: 13925"] I have come into two small tracts of land via real estate investments. I am interested in making the land productive for my own benefit. I really don't have much farming experience but I have been doing some reading of late and I find it very interesting. My wife and I both have full time steady income so we would not be relying on the farm income to sustain ourselves. We are looking for additional income sources. Both of these properties are in Alabama. One tract is 21 acres, approx 50% timber and 50% pasture. It is already fenced with barbed wire and there is an existing catch pen. There is also spring water on the property. I intend to sell the majority of the timber to generate cash. There is also a 3bd/1ba house on the property that i plan on renting out. The next tract is only 3 acres. It is all cleared land, already fenced with barbed wire, has a small creek and a 3bd/2ba house on it that I intend to rent out.
